About The Position

Sese Industrial is a greenfield operation that has an immediate opening for a Process Engineer. We are seeking a detail-oriented engineer to set up and monitor our operations to determine the most efficient production process. He or she will design/improve production layouts and processes with the purpose of increasing productivity, eliminating wastefulness, reducing costs, and ensuring quality standards are maintained.

Responsibilities

  • Conduct VSM Activities within the facility
  • Troubleshooting problems with associated manufacturing processes
  • Determine the most effective ways to use the basic factors of production — people, machines, materials, information, and energy — to make a product or to provide a service.
  • Conduct time studies and facilitate line balancing activities.
  • Review engineering specifications and conduct risk assessments
  • Design control systems and coordinate activities and production planning
  • Conduct research to develop new and improved processes for manufacturing.
  • Specifications to 3rd party Equipment Developers and Integrators by developing, configuring, and optimizing industrial processes from inception through to start up and certification, by utilizing but not limited to developing Scopes, RFQs, and Microsoft Projects Software.
  • Communicates findings and proposals to upper management.
  • Assessing processes, taking measurements, and interpreting data.
  • Designing, running, testing, and upgrading systems and processes. (Adding Auto-stations to systems)
  • Provide Quote information tooling / manning requirements.
  • Manage cost and time constraints.
  • Develop best practices, routines, and innovative solutions to improve production rates and quality of output.
  • Perform process simulations.
  • Update and control PFMEA, Flow Chart & Control Plan.
  • Design layout of building, machines and equipment, material handling system raw materials and finished goods storage facilities.
  • Maintain layout of facility and make updates as required.
  • Perform risk assessments.
  • Perform Ergonomics reviews and make recommendation for improvements.
  • Provide process documentation and operating instructions.
  • Development of time standards, costing, and performance standards.
  • Selection of processes and assembling methods.
  • Selection and design of tools and equipment.
  • Design and improvement of planning and control systems for production, inventory, quality, and plant maintenance.
  • Cost control systems.
  • Development and installation of job evaluation systems.
  • Design and installation of value stream mapping for process.
  • Supplier selection and evaluation.
